Human Body System Flip Book
Human Body System Flip Book
Students will build a flip book on the differenty body systems, illustrate, and label, also they will illustrate 4 major organs in the body and label. They will create a table of contents, glossary and craetive cover for their book.

Human Body Project
Excellent
25 pts
Good
20 pts
Fair
15 pts
Poor
10 pts
Stays on Focus
Excellent
Student stays on task all of the time without reminders.
Good
Students stays on task most of the time.
Fair
Students stays on task some of the time.
Poor
Student hardly ever stays on task.
Student lets others do the work.
Construction of Body System
Excellent
Construction is neat and FULLY depicts the systems and organs of the our body system.
System is labeled properly.
System is creative and attractive.
Good
Construction was neat and careful for the most part.
One or two details could have been added to make construction more creative and attractive.
Fair
Construction adequately depicts the body system.
Some labels have been omitted.
System is not attractive or creative, they didn't include table of contents or glossary.
Poor
Construction is careless and not attractive.
Many labels are omitted was not completed.
Construction of the Booklet
Excellent
Booklet contained what was required and possible more about the body systems and organs. It was organized, neat, and written down properly and a table of contents and glossary were completed properly.
Good
Booklet contained what was required about the body systems and organs. It was somewhat organized, neat, and written down properly and a table of contents and glossary were completed.
Fair
Booklet contained some of what was required about the body systems and organs. It was not to organized or neat, or written down properly. Only part of table of contents and glossary were completed.
Poor
Major content is missing, no table of contents or glossary. Illustration and labels not readable or correct.
Neatness
Excellent
Coloring is neatly done and correctly colored so each organ in the system is discernable and organs are correctly colored (red, blue)
Good
Mostly displays neat- ness of colored parts of the body.
Fair
Only part of the system and organs are colored neatly and correctly.
Poor
Cannot discern parts of the system or organs and not neat or correct.
